**Q: How do I open the first-aid room out of hours?**

The first-aid room on Level 1 of Darnell Court stays locked overnight to protect supplies. Facilities desk staff may open it for any genuine medical need — no approval required, but log the access afterwards in the incident book. The defibrillator cabinet beside the door is separate and alarmed. To unlock the first-aid room itself, enter the code below.

turnstile pass: bdg-QZV-3

Runbook fragment: account recovery — FleetLedger fuel report

Reviewer note: if the reporting service account for the FleetLedger fuel-usage report is locked out, the nightly aggregation of liters-per-route will silently skip depots. Recovery steps: disable the scheduler, reset the account via the admin console, then re-run the aggregation for the missed window. Verify totals against the depot manifests before re-enabling. The console reset prompt will ask for the recovery passphrase, which follows.

strongbox words: norir-zorox-brivan-holmir-wenius-zorath-kaseth

Visitors to the Rookmere training studio must be pre-booked and escorted at all times. Recording sessions are closed-door: no walk-ins, no waiting inside the live room. Escorts sign visitors in at the studio logbook, not main reception. Equipment stays on site. Facilities staff granting after-hours escort access should use the studio door code below.

staff pass of kawip-hawef = bdg-QLP-2

## Limits and Quotas — Rowan CSV Import Wizard

These limits protect the ingest workers from oversized uploads and pathological row widths. They were chosen after the Hollis dataset incident; raising any of them requires load-testing the parser pool first. All are enforced server-side, so client-side checks are advisory only. The enforced constants are:

limits module of tafof-kagef:
RATE_LIMITS = {
    "zorix": 10,
    "ralath": 1,
    "quenwyn": 2,
    "holael": 10,
}